Abstract: An electronic device detects, on a touch-sensitive surface, a user input directed to a user interface element associated with a respective operation, for example in a user interface for a locked mode of operation of the device. A first portion of the user input includes an increase in intensity of the contact followed by a second portion of the user input that includes a decrease in intensity of the contact. In response to the user input, the device displays a transformation of the user interface element, wherein a degree of the transformation is determined based on an intensity of the user input. If the user input satisfies feed-forward criteria, including a requirement that a characteristic intensity of the contact increase above a feed-forward intensity threshold, the device generates a first tactile output without performing the respective operation. Otherwise, the device generates a second tactile output and performs the respective operation.

Abstract: An electronic device displays a user interface for a first software application. The user interface includes multiple elements to which user interaction models from multiple user interaction models provided by an application-independent module have been assigned (including a first element to which a first user interaction model has been assigned). The multiple elements have content provided by an application-specific module for the first software application. The first user interaction model defines how the user interface responds to inputs directed to the first element. The device detects an input directed to the first element; and updates the user interface based on characteristics of the input. If the input meets tactile output criteria specified by the first user interaction model, the device generates a first tactile output corresponding to the input, and if not, the device forgoes generation of the first tactile output.

Abstract: A method, comprising: at an electronic device with a display, a touch-sensitive surface, and one or more tactile output generators: displaying a user interface on the display; while displaying the user interface on the display and while the one or more tactile output generators are in a low power state, detecting a first user interaction via the touch-sensitive surface; in response to detecting the first user interaction, setting the one or more tactile output generators to a low latency state; after setting the one or more tactile output generators to the low-latency state, detecting a second user interaction that is part of a same sequence of user interactions as the first user interaction; and in response to detecting the second user interaction, generating a tactile output that corresponds to the second user interaction.

Abstract: An electronic device: displays a home button configuration user interface with a plurality of different tactile output settings for the home button. While displaying the home button configuration user interface, the device detects selection of a respective tactile output setting. In response to detecting a first input of a first type on the home button (while the respective tactile output setting is selected), the device determines whether the respective tactile output setting is a first or a second tactile output setting for the home button. If the respective tactile output setting is the first tactile output setting, the device provides a first tactile output without dismissing the home button configuration user interface. If the respective tactile output setting is the second tactile output setting, the device provides a second tactile output without dismissing the home button configuration user interface.
